Flexible Grid System Help

I am trying to replicate this Square Space grid layout.

I’ve managed to get quite close with Flex Box on this page here:

However, you’ll notice the last few images stretch and distort from the square shape that I really desire. Any help or advice would be appreciated.

Example Image

My Current State
current state

Can it be that you set the box to be min-width: 270 and max-width: 300 ? So you get a 30px difference one each box?
How about setting it to width: 300px

If you share the publick link its easier to play around.

Oh thanks for that. Here’s the link. This page in particular is called Projects.


